    Entirely possible this is just me not understanding how to make this work in MF; Normally I just select presets from HubHop, but of course with how new Starship is, there's very few at the moment. I've managed to figure out most of the bindings I want, but the CHP joystick is only halfway there.

    I've assigned a hat switch on my throttle to H:MFD_Joystick_Up/Down/Left/Right, and this works as expected on the MFD map screens to move the cursor. Setting a repeat on hold allows me to move the cursor for as long as I hold in a direction. The problem shows up on the checklists; These binds do not work unless I interact with the joystick in the virtual cockpit first, and then it only works once. I understand there is also H:MFD_PageAdvance, and I find it works as intended. However I'd prefer to just use the joystick binds, as this should also allow going backwards through the list.
    Is there something I'm missing, or is this an actual issue?

    A more minor issue I have is with the prop governor test switch. Due to momentary nature of the switch, even if I set a repeat of 1 ms it still visually and audibly twitches between neutral and the selected position. The actual tests don't seem to be negatively affected by this, so it's just a minor irritation from the sound of the switch. Is there anything that can be done about this?

      For the CHP joystick, just send the event H:MFD_Joystick_Center when you return the joystick to center.

              I had a similar issue with the CWS button in the Duke, and for my hardware the solution was to use the _IsDown variable. Try PropGovTestSwitch_IsDown instead maybe? Send it once and then zero it on release.
